Poems about the second day of February
1. On February 2nd, the river went up, and the east wind blew warm and the sun blew. --"February 2nd" by Li Shangyin of the Tang Dynasty
Translation: On February 2nd, I went out to the river for a spring outing, and the spring breeze and sunshine brought warmth and melodious music.
2. It rained and cleared on February 2nd, and sprouts sprouted for a while. -- "February 2nd" by Bai Juyi of the Tang Dynasty
Translation: On February 2nd, the new rain began to fall, and the grass and vegetables in the fields all sprouted buds, creating a scene full of spring.
3. I don’t know who cuts out the thin leaves. The spring breeze in February is like scissors. -- "Ode to Willows/Willow Branches" by He Zhizhang of the Tang Dynasty
Translation: Whose skillful hands cut these thin young leaves? It turned out to be the warm spring breeze in February, like a pair of dexterous scissors.
4. There is no youth in the New Year, and I was surprised to see grass buds in early February. -- "Spring Snow" by Han Yu of the Tang Dynasty
Translation: The New Year has come, but there are no fragrant flowers yet. In February, I was pleasantly surprised to find new shoots of grass sprouting.
5. The leaves fall off in three autumns and can bloom in February. --"Wind" by Li Qiao of the Tang Dynasty
Translation: It can blow down the golden leaves in autumn and open the beautiful flowers in spring.
6. Pingping is more than thirteen years old, and the cardamom leaves are in early February. -- "Two Farewell Songs" by Du Mu of the Tang Dynasty
Translation: The beautiful posture and light demeanor are exactly the thirteenth year, just like a cardamom flower in bud in early February.
7. In February, the branches in the south of the Yangtze River are full of flowers, and the cold food in a foreign country is far from sad. -- "Cold Food" by Meng Yunqing of the Tang Dynasty
Translation: The branches of Jiangnan flowers are in full bloom in February. It is sad enough to celebrate the Cold Food Festival in a foreign country.
